The town is situated on the most northern point of the Danube, nestling among gently rolling hills, where grapes have been grown since the Roman times. The town began as a Celtic settlement, then becaume the Roman fort 'Casta Regina' and later the capital of Bavaria and seat of the Reichtag until 1806. Regensburg, a city fortunate enough never to have been destroyed.
